82 This is my current favorite South Florida brewery and place to drink. Their taps rotate regularly, with new offerings almost every week. Without fail a friendly vibe, very Miami. Food comes from a rotating truck out back. Often there are guest taps but at times their house brew list is long enough to fill all the taps. They do fabulous, creative collaboration brews with known and emerging breweries. Currently they make the house beer Captain Kush for the Lokal restaurant in the Grove. Beers range from sours to smoked beers to light lagers and imperial stouts. Beers are mostly hit, the seasonals are the most interesting and unique. The location is perfect for me, it is walking distance from mom's house. Family friendly, especially during the day and on the back patio. Easy access of the Palmetto. Their live music program is incredible. Nothing but good to say, so grateful to have them in the area, there is nothing else like this around. |
